Jackson Ferris' dream NRL debut for Cronulla has been further soured with the centre facing a three-game suspension for a shoulder charge.
The 22-year-old could be back in a fortnight if he takes an early guilty plea, with carryover points from lower grades coming back to bite.
Jackson will be suspended for one match if he enters an early guilty plea and risks a two-match ban if he challenges the charge at the judiciary and loses.
